Alcohol Content in Seagram's Wine Coolers. Seagram's Wine Coolers come in a variety of flavors and styles, and their alcohol content can vary depending on the specific product. Here's a breakdown: Most Seagram's Escapes: These are the classic coolers you're likely familiar with and contain 3.2% alcohol by volume (ABV).This is similar to the alcohol content of light beer.

For an average sized man of 190lbs (or 89kg), it would take 6-7 beers of 3.2% ABV to get legally drunk in the US. For an average 160 pounds woman (or 72kg) it would take 4-5 beers of 3.2% ABV to get legally drunk in the US. Legally drunk means you'll have equal to or more than 0.08% of blood alcohol content.

Does Wine Coolers get you drunk? Wine coolers are alcoholic beverages, so they can get you drunk if you consume enough of them. They typically contain around 4-7% alcohol by volume, which is similar to the alcohol content in beer. However, because they are sweet and fruity, some people might not realize how much alcohol they are consuming.
